Re: [patch/rfc] default REGISTER_VIRTUAL_SIZE and REGISTER_RAW_SIZE to register_size


On May 5, 10:28pm, Andrew Cagney wrote:

> For most architectures.  The relationship:
> 
> 	REGISTER_VIRTUAL_SIZE(N)
> 	== REGISTER_RAW_SIZE(N)
> 	== TYPE_LENGTH(REGISTER_VIRTUAL_TYPE(N)
> 
> (the exception is the @$(*&@(^$*&^!@ MIPS ...).  Given this, the 
> attached patch changes the architecture vector so that it defaults both 
> to the register's type size.
> 
> I think this is the logical conclusion to MichaelS's earlier patch that 
> provided defaults to each.
> 
> Thoughts?  I'll look to commit it in a week.

It looks okay to me.
